Update live migration to use v3 cinder api
With cinder v3, the new live migration flow is to create new volume attachments on the destination host during pre_live_migration, and then after a successful live migration, delete the attachments on the source host. If the live migration fails, the attachments on the destination host will be deleted. A new dictionary, old_vol_attachment_ids, is added (without persistence) to migrate_data. This will store the original attachment_ids of the source host's attachments. If the migrate fails, the attachment_id in the bdm will be replaced with the old attachment_id. An existing unit test, test_pre_live_migration_handles_dict, is updated to avoid an exception thrown by the new code. A fake instance is now used instead of a simple dict. 6 new unit tests are added.
